731 State St., Madison, Wisconsin. County/parish: Dane.
Added to the National Register of Historic Places October 16, 2002. NRIS 02001185.
1 contributing building.Also known as:
The University Presbyterian Church and Student Center, nicknamed Pres House, is a historic church on State Street in Madison, Wisconsin, United States. Designed in 1931 by local architect Edward Tough in a Gothic Revival style, and after a delay occasioned by the Great Depression it was completed four years later.
